Acceptance Rate & Admission Statistics
For academic year 2021-2022, total 22,791 students have applied to University of Illinois Chicago. By gender, 9,623 male and 13,168 female students have applied to the school. Among them, 17,960 (7,167 male and 10,793 female) students have accepted and 4,177(1,844 male and 2,333 female) have enrolled into University of Illinois Chicago for academic year 2021-2022. SAT and ACT Scores Distribution
At University of Illinois Chicago, 1,317 applicants (32% of enrolled) have submitted their SAT scores and 319 applicants (8%) have submitted their ACT scores for seeking degrees. For score submitters, SAT 75th percentile score is 1,310 and 25th percentile score is 1,080. For ACT scores, 75th percentile score is 93 and 25th percentile score is 67. The SAT and ACT scores are considered but not required to submit when applying to University of Illinois Chicago.
